GTA 6: Rumors Suggest User-Generated Content and Potential Creator Integration
2025-02-18 08:18:02Recent rumors indicate Rockstar Games may be considering incorporating user-generated content (UGC) into Grand Theft Auto 6. This strategy, popularized by games like Fortnite and Roblox, could revolutionize GTA 6's online experience and further solidify its position in the gaming world.
Officially announced in 2023, GTA 6 introduced protagonists Jason and Lucia, and confirmed the much-anticipated return to Vice City. The initial trailer garnered immense attention with over 220 million views. However, official details have been scarce since the announcement.
A report from Digiday, citing three industry insiders, suggests Rockstar is exploring ways to empower creators within GTA 6. This could involve modifying assets and environments, offering a level of customization previously unseen in the franchise. However, the specifics of this potential collaboration remain unclear, including how creators might be incentivized beyond exposure.
Rockstar's interest in player-created content isn't new. The 2023 acquisition of CFX.RE, the team behind popular roleplay servers for GTA Online and Red Dead Online, demonstrates their recognition of the value and potential of community-driven content. Given the popularity of roleplaying in GTA 5, it's likely Rockstar aims to replicate and expand this success in GTA 6's online mode.

While an official release date remains elusive, GTA 6 is anticipated to launch on Xbox Series X/S and PlayStation 5 in Fall 2025. Rumors suggest a PC port may follow in early 2026, according to Corsair Gaming’s VP of Finance, Ronald van Veen.
